#2b0806 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2b0806 is composed of 16.9% red, 3.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 86% yellow and 83.1%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 9.6%. #2b0806 color hex could be obtained by blending #56100c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#2b0806

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b0806

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1a1717 is the less saturated color, while #310300 is the most saturated one.
